Little Island BIG Adventure (LIBA) is pleased to offer “Bermuda’s Treasures” A Youth Geocaching Program that brings technology, history and the outdoors together, in a Teachable Entertainment Environment (TEE)
I am excited about the opportunity to provide your child/children with an opportunity to learn the sport of Geocaching which uses GPS technology. It also provide

s them with a new skill that they can utilize here in Bermuda or when they travel on vacation. Each treasure cache offers an opportunity to learn interesting facts and stories about our History, Geography and Topography. Parents you can utilize this offering for “school mid-term”, “weekend”, “shopping” or “need some time for myself” breaks! Reserving your space is required. We will focus on the following:
• Basic Maps and GPS skills
• The History of Geocaching - Geocacher Etiquette - CITO
• Geocache Types - Glossary of Terms
• Computer - Post Geocaching Activity
• Historical Facts & Fiction
• How this new skill can add value to family vacations
Our learning will include iconic places like World Heritage Center, Fort St. Catherine, Bermuda Aquarium Museum & Zoo, Bermuda Underwater Exploration Institute, National Museum of Bermuda and Bermuda Institute of Ocean Sciences. Description:
Every day is packed with an outdoor adventure, learning, and hands on GPS time, fitness and play in a relaxed and happy atmosphere.
